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Czy istnieje jakakolwiek klasa w MySql, która jest podobna do klasy BulkCopy w SQL Server 2005?

O ile wiem, nie ma, ale istnieje kilka instrukcji, które można uruchomić, które są podobne do sposobu, w jaki wykonuje się wstawianie zbiorcze za pomocą TSQL.

SqlCommand sql
sql.CommandText = "LOAD DATA INFILE '" + path + "' INTO TABLE att_temp FIELDS TERMINATED BY '\t' ENCLOSED BY '\"' LINES TERMINATED BY '\n'";

Ta składnia może nie być całkiem właściwa, ponieważ nie musiałem jej używać, ale zastanawiałem się, jak wykonać wstawianie zbiorcze, gdybyśmy zdecydowali się otworzyć bazę danych na więcej, a nie tylko na SqlServer.




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jaki jest najłatwiejszy sposób ustalenia, czy użytkownik jest online? (PHP/MYSQL)

  2. PHP MySQL INSERT zwraca wartość z jednym wykonaniem zapytania

  3. Jak usunąć wszystkie zduplikowane rekordy w PHP/Mysql?

  4. Zapytanie Mysql zwracające identyfikator zasobu #8 zamiast żądanej wartości

  5. USUŃ Z „tabeli” JAKO „alias” ... GDZIE „alias”. „kolumna” ... dlaczego błąd składni?